The Institute of Chemistry of Ireland has launched a book to mark the 75th anniversary of its foundation in 1922, as the Chemical Association of Ireland. A copy of the 240-page history, entitled The Chemical Association of Ireland 1922- 1936, written by Dr J. Philip Ryan, was presented yesterday to the Minister of State for Science Technology and Commerce, Mr Noel Treacy. The book is available from the institute.
